Polyvinyl chloride (PVC), a polymer made from monomer vinyl chloride, is a good example. It is one of the most frequently used plastics. It is resistant to water, chemicals, sunlight, and oxygen. PVC is also a highly flexible polymer that can be used in a variety applications.

The most commonly used application for PVC is in the manufacturing of pipes. Because of its flexibility, it is able to be made into different shapes. These pipes are also very robust and can withstand pressure of water and other liquids.

Window frames are another major application for PVC. These windows are strong and offer excellent insulation. They are constructed of a safe, eco-friendly material that is free of phthalates, BPA, or other harmful substances.

Unplasticized PVC is a rigid plastic is another type of PVC. This is a rigid plastic which can be used for pipes and window frames.

Unplasticized PVC is suitable for ANSI certification. However, it is not able to maintain low temperature stability. Additionally, certain hydrocarbons may leach the plasticizers of UPVC.

CPVC is a chlorinated plastic. Chlorinated plastic is stronger since it has a higher density than uPVC. It also has a better glass transition. CPVC can be shaped, welded, and then processed to be used in a variety of different products.

In comparison to uPVC, CPVC is easier to cut with power tools and has greater resistance to heat. CPVC can be recycled.
